Christian Louboutin ripped off?


My FAVORITE shoe designer in the whole entire world , Christian Louboutin keeps getting ripped off by cheap imitations! Known for famous red soles on his unique and fabulous shoes. First cheaper brands were copying him and puttin red soles on their shoes , until the court intervened and they were no longer allowed to do that. Now another designer , Steve Madden is doing the unthinkable copying the shoe exactly , everything BUT the red sole. Is it an inspiration or is it just lack of imagination? Take a look at the picture of the booties one is the real and one is the Steve Madden imitation , it looks EXACTLY the same. Another designer that took it up a notch was Nine West who copied a pair of heels right down to the red soles! Is it fair to Christian Louboutin lovers who actually pay $700 , just like people who buy Louis Vuitton bags for $700 and others buy imitations for 20 bucks?

Christian Dior fashion show marks 60th anniversary

The annual autumn/winter Christian Dior fashion show was packed with countless celebrities, such as Charlize Theron , Jessica Alba and Kate Hudson. Charlize Theron was wearing a black gown with chiffon sleeves and a red rose with dramatic silver eyes and shimmery pink lips. Kate Hudson was very 60’s wearing a loose flowy yellow dress and sporting very light shimmery makeup. Jessica Alba looked a lot more sophisticated and chic wearing a sparkling gold fitting gown with dark makeup playing up her gorgeous eyes and skin. This marked the 60th anniversary of Dior and 10th anniversary of having British designer John Galliano at the helm. His collection was 40’s mixed with old Hollywood glamour. Also it had a Japanese theme with kimonos, animated origami folding and traditional Japanese hair and makeup. The collection was considered surprisingly wearable, bright colors , skirts in all different styles accentuating small waists. The glamorous elements were gloves, jewels and a lot of fur trim.

ROBERTO CAVALLI FOR H&M

H&M : A dream for fashionistas in New York. When H&M first opened up , it was looked down upon until Madonna came out with a line for the store. Noone in their wildest dreams could ever imagine Roberto Cavalli would sell his collection there. I mean Roberto Cavalli which sells shirts for thousands of dollars , selling his collection for close to nothing. Roberto Cavalli isn’t the first premier designer to launch a line at a store not as highend as Bloomingdales and Saks. Designers such as Vera Wang, Cynthia Rowley , and Isaac Mizrahi have all designed affordable lines for Target. At the premiere of the line at the 5th avenue location , there were lines and lines of fans of the designer waiting to snatch up at least something. You could imagine how many bloody noses and ambulances were called. The collection is full of signature Cavalli clothing , animal prints , silk , and other gorgeous prints. There are over 20 different pieces in his women’s collection. Leopard and zebra is a significant theme in the women’s collection, and features on dresses, tops, coats and lingerie. A tailored jacket is teamed with slim slacks or shorts. A leather jacket is decorated with fringes and laces and a fake-fur jacket has eyelets and studs. An elegant trench coat has piping and metallic studs. A heavily embellished jacket adds instant glamour to tight fitting or wide leg jeans. A leopard-print or black corset top look dazzling on bare skin for evening or over a T-shirt for day, and there are several blouses with animal prints, ruffles and bows. Knitwear consists of a leopard-print or black oversized cardigan and a tank mini dress with ruffles. For evening or cocktail wear: a sequined mini dress, a chiffon baby doll dress in zebra stripe or leopard print, a long metallic pleated halter dress and a long animal print dress.
